Between 1958 and 1962, Fife Symington ran in 3 U.S. House elections, losing all 3. Symington's biggest single-election total was 89,262 votes, in the 1960 U.S. House election in Maryland's District 2.

Election history

Fife Symington’s election history
YearOfficeResultVotesOpponent(s)
1962U.S. HouseMarylandLost79,07548.08%Clarence D. Long
1960U.S. HouseMarylandLost89,26241.38%Daniel Brewster (head-to-head)
1958U.S. HouseMarylandLost56,16539.05%Daniel Brewster (head-to-head)
